#d456d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d456d2 is composed of 83.1% red, 33.7%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.4% magenta, 0.9%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 301 degrees, a saturation of 59.4% and a lightness of 58.4%. #d456d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#a900a5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#d456d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d456d2 has RGB values of R:212, G:86,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.01,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13915858.

Shades and Tints of #d456d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#fcf2fc is the lightest one.
